There are two main conversion processes used for the production of acetylene. One of them is a chemical reaction process that takes place at normal temperatures. Another is the thermal cracking process, which takes place at extremely high temperatures.

Acetylene can be produced by a chemical reaction between calcium carbide and water. This reaction causes a significant amount of heat to be removed to prevent the explosion of the acetylene gas. There are several variations of this process in which calcium carbide is added to water or water is added to calcium carbide. Both of these options are called wet processes because excess water is used to absorb the heat of reaction. The third option, called the dry process, uses only a limited amount of water, which then evaporates as it is absorbed.
